WN系统之家 - 操作系统光盘下载网站!

当前位置: 首页  >  教程资讯 asp文件管理系统源码,功能与实现

asp文件管理系统源码,功能与实现

时间:2024-11-22 来源:网络 人气:

深入解析ASP文件管理系统源码:功能与实现

一、ASP文件管理系统概述

ASP文件管理系统是一种基于ASP技术的文件上传、下载、分享和管理的系统。它允许用户在服务器上创建文件夹、上传文件、下载文件、分享文件链接以及进行文件权限管理等操作。以下将详细介绍ASP文件管理系统的核心功能。

二、ASP文件管理系统功能解析

1. 文件上传

文件上传是文件管理系统的基础功能。ASP文件管理系统支持用户上传单个或多个文件,并对上传的文件进行大小和类型的限制,确保上传过程的安全性和稳定性。

2. 文件下载

文件下载功能允许用户下载服务器上的文件。系统会自动生成下载链接,用户只需点击链接即可下载文件。同时,系统支持断点续传,提高下载效率。

3. 文件分享

文件分享功能允许用户将文件链接分享给他人。系统会为每个分享的文件生成一个提取码,确保只有拥有正确提取码的用户才能下载文件,提高文件安全性。

4. 文件管理

文件管理功能包括创建文件夹、删除文件、重命名文件、移动文件等操作。用户可以根据自己的需求对文件进行管理,提高文件使用效率。

5. 文件权限管理

文件权限管理功能允许管理员为不同用户设置不同的文件访问权限,如查看、下载、修改、删除等。这样可以确保文件的安全性,防止未经授权的用户访问敏感文件。

三、ASP文件管理系统关键技术

1. 文件上传与下载

文件上传和下载功能主要依赖于ASP内置的Request和Response对象。通过Request对象获取上传的文件信息,通过Response对象发送下载文件的数据流。

2. 文件存储

文件存储是文件管理系统的核心。ASP文件管理系统通常采用数据库存储文件信息,如文件名、文件大小、上传时间等。同时,文件本身存储在服务器上的指定目录。

3. 文件权限控制

文件权限控制主要依赖于ASP的Session和Cookie技术。系统为每个用户创建一个会话,记录用户的登录状态和权限信息。在访问文件时,系统会根据用户的权限信息判断是否允许访问。

4. 文件分享与提取码

文件分享和提取码功能主要依赖于ASP的加密和解密技术。系统为每个分享的文件生成一个随机提取码,并将其加密存储在数据库中。用户在下载文件时,系统会验证提取码的正确性。

ASP文件管理系统源码具有功能强大、易于扩展、安全性高等特点。通过本文的解析,相信读者对ASP文件管理系统的功能实现和关键技术有了更深入的了解。在实际开发过程中,可以根据需求对源码进行修改和扩展,以满足不同场景下的应用需求。

ASP文件管理系统,源码,文件上传,文件下载,文件分享,文件管理,文件权限,关键技术


作者 小编

教程资讯

教程资讯排行

系统教程

主题下载